The University of Saskatchewan Library established the Saskatchewan Music Collection in 1997.  Initially housed in Special Collections, it was transferred to the Education branch library in 2001.   The collection includes musical material written, performed, produced or recorded by individuals with a significant link to the province.  Researchers interested specifically in the First Nations and Métis music within that collection can search the “Saskatchewan music” link below.
